Home > Cpu Usage > Linux Command To Get Cpu Usage Of A Process

Linux Command To Get Cpu Usage Of A Process


If anyone is aware of any of such method, please reply fast, i require it urgently.Regards Youvedeep Singh Reply Link Nicholas February 20, 2009, 7:02 amHow I get the word size However there are several other execution states including running the kernel and servicing interrupts. The top section contains information related to overall system status - uptime, load average, process counts, CPU status, and utilization statistics for both memory and swap space.Top command to find out Reply Link Rey July 23, 2010, 2:45 pmIs there anyway to determine CPU cycles currently in use and available CPU Cycles. have a peek here

LinuxQuestions.org > Forums > Linux Forums > Linux - Newbie How to get %CPU usage of a process User Name Remember Me? If the niceness level is greater than zero then the user has been courteous enough lower to the priority of the process and therefore avoid a CPU overload. Reply Link nixCraft October 8, 2007, 7:21 pm>should I do something to configure it, what should I doYup, ask your admin to install Linux SMP kernel and boot into the same SN Oct21 0:00 /usr/bin/python -tt /usr/sbin/yum-updatesd root 2406 0.0 0.9 11572 10004 ?

How To Check Cpu Utilization In Linux Command

Reply Link Tini March 26, 2009, 6:50 amThis article really helped me a lot. Have a CPU intensive process that can be run at a lower priority? I need to find how much CPU httpd consumed in last second. Reply Link Sharad January 10, 2011, 12:26 pmThis helps, thanks!

  • Now start another matho-primes process in the cpulimited group: sudo cgexec -g cpu:cpulimited /usr/local/bin/matho-primes 0 9999999999 > /dev/null & Observe how the CPU is still being proportioned in a 2:1 ratio.
  • I have found out from some of the forums and man page for iostat that the disk utilization report ought to show one parameter called %util.
  • It's great as a supervisor/watchdog for other processes.
  • Required fields are marked *Comment Name * Email * Website Notify me of followup comments via e-mail.
  • It allows you to view and control the processes running on your system.

share|improve this answer answered Jun 30 '13 at 4:31 Aquarius Power 1,12611125 add a comment| up vote 1 down vote If you know process name you can use top -p $(pidof The CPU line will look something like this: %Cpu(s):24.8us,0.5sy,0.0ni,73.6id,0.4wa,0.0hi,0.2si,0.0st 24.8 us - This tells us that the processor is spending 24.8% of its time running user space processes. It changes the niceness level of an already running process. Top Cpu Consuming Process In Linux Reply Gabriel A.

This work is licensed under a (cc) BY-NC The material in this site cannot be republished either online or offline, without our permission. Linux Cpu Usage Per Process Reply Link Diptanjan June 12, 2007, 6:10 amThis is really a wonderful article…Learned a lot from this… And thank you all the readers for posting valuable comments with different commands.. From the above the best I got was "cat /proc/cpuinfo|grep processor|wc -l" - but I don't suspect it would ‘port' from RedHat to a Sun, HP or AIX box. Hope that this helps.

A possible cause of such spikes could be a problem with a driver/kernel module. Cpu Utilization In Linux Is High When Linux is running as a virtual machine on a hypervisor, the st (short for stolen) statistic shows how long the virtual CPU has spent waiting for the hypervisor to service Find More Posts by ajucan 07-04-2006, 10:58 AM #8 Pravab Member Registered: Apr 2006 Location: Dharan,Nepal Distribution: FC5 Posts: 63 Rep: in FEDORACORE they have the option called "SYSTEM does this mean that disks in my raid work that way,,, one reads data, other write it ? … strange..

Linux Cpu Usage Per Process

The CPU limitation only comes into effect when two or more processes compete for CPU resources. visit Join our community today! How To Check Cpu Utilization In Linux Command Other OSes also exist that use the same kernel (such as Android and more traditional distributions like Fedora or Ubuntu), and others that use different kernels(e.g. How To Check Cpu Utilization In Unix For A Process Appreciate if any one could help me on this.My server is ProLiant DL380 G3 model which is a 32 bit CPU server.

By default, the output will be sorted in ascendant form, but personally I prefer to reverse that order by adding a minus sign in front of the sort criteria. http://arnoldtechweb.com/cpu-usage/linux-cpu-usage-program.html Reply Link surjan September 21, 2011, 6:45 amNice article and equally good comments suggesting the new commands. I know that with the “1” argument I can see each CPU listed. Ss Oct21 0:01 hald root 18453 0.0 0.2 10140 2884 ? Linux Track Process Memory Usage Over Time

What is mean by CPU percentage? There are 3 general states your CPU can be in: Idle, which means it has nothing to do. Aaron Kili says: @Nena Try to remove the Apache2 default page... http://arnoldtechweb.com/cpu-usage/linux-usb-cpu-usage.html A software interrupt doesn't occur at the CPU level, but rather at the kernel level. 0.0 st - This last number only applies to virtual machines.

why!!!!! Process Cpu Usage Windows Learn how to build Ruby apps at scale. Reply shraboni dey says: May 30, 2016 at 4:58 pm Not getting the difference between Debian and Linux.

One of the nice things about vmstat is that it provides an insight into how the queues are filling up on each processor.

Thank you. In the directory:/sys/devices/system/cpu, I can see only one cpu - cpu0. pmem %MEM see %mem. (alias %mem). Hp Caliper There are lots of them. –vwduder Jan 13 '11 at 11:33 Memory usage over a given time frame, current usage, maximum usage, average. –Josh K Jan 13 '11 at

nixcraftThanks, htop worked great for debian sarge, mpstat didn't worked very well. I've trimmed down some of the output from the ps man page to show what I think the most important sort keys are. to monitor these two process IDs (12345 and 11223) every 5 seconds use $ pidstat -h -r -u -v -p 12345,11223 5 share|improve this answer edited Mar 24 '16 at 12:35 this contact form Thank you!

but makes my head think about that :) Reply Link TeeCee January 4, 2012, 8:11 [email protected],I would guess from the numbers that sda and sdb are 1TB drives. Its really helpful. VnStat PHP monitors a network traffic usage in nicely graphical mode. Sine it appears to have read 1TB from sda and written it to sd, mygues is t thiis the mirrorin process.

The disadvantage over nice is that the process can't use all of the available CPU time when the system is idle. euid EUID effective user ID. (alias uid). Reply Link Michael Shigorin September 24, 2012, 11:20 amThere's no such thing as "urgent requirement" when you don't compensate people in some way. bsdtime TIME accumulated cpu time, user + system.